python cv2批量灰度图片并保存

import cv2
#循环灰度图片并保存
def grayImg():
    for x in range(1,38):
        #读取图片
        img = cv2.imread("C:\\Users\\lyl\\Desktop\\new_dahuoji\\img2\\{}.jpg".format(str(x)))
        GrayImage=cv2.cvtColor(img,cv2.COLOR_BGR2GRAY)
        #保存灰度后的新图片
        cv2.imwrite("C:\\Users\\lyl\\Desktop\\1\\myProject\\pictures\\dataset2\\dahuomiao\\{}.jpg".format(str(x)),GrayImage)
grayImg()

猜你喜欢

转载自blog.csdn.net/qq_32502511/article/details/79010202